Overview
This CSS-only extension hides most persistent generative AI elements from Google properties, including Search, Docs, Drive, and GMail. Note that this extension only hides UI elements; it does not affect any backend calls or disable the product in its entirety. To avoid potential compatibility issues, it does not attempt to hide one-time promotional messages (like the first time “try using Gemini for X” popups) and only focuses on hiding the main persistent UI elements that activate the product.
Current limitations:
- Cannot hide elements within the Google Docs <canvas> (e.g. the “help me write” that appears on a blank Document)
- Cannot hide things in Google Earth (it’s all one big <canvas>)
- Probably more? Feedback appreciated. Many of the items that I’ve hidden were first reported by users like you!
